The station might be modest in size, but it includes essential amenities to ensure a smooth journey. Although there's no ticket office, worry not—you can easily purchase and collect tickets from the available ticket machines. Additionally, the station is fitted with smartcard validators and has an induction loop for hearing-impaired travelers.
If you're concerned about accessibility, you’ll be relieved to know there is step-free access in parts of the station. This facility is critical for travelers requiring mobility support, although do note that there are no available ramps for train access or accessible toilets.
Barrow-upon-Soar train station offers a few onward travel options for continuing your journey. For those requiring a rail replacement service, you can find it conveniently located on South Street, right outside the Hunting Lodge. If a taxi is more your style, ACE ABC can be reached at 01509 215500. Although not bustling with numerous amenities, these essentials ensure you can move seamlessly to your next destination.

Nutbourne Station is the epitome of convenience for travelers accustomed to independent travel. While you won’t find a ticket office here, there are ticket machines available which allow collection of pre-purchased tickets. These machines are accessible with support for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. However, do plan ahead, as there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ities on site. CCTV provides enhanced security, ensuring peace of mind as you embark on your travels.
Although Nutbourne is an unstaffed station, assistance is never far away. The help points on both platforms provide vital support, and there are audible announcements and departure screens to keep you informed. Should you need special assistance, contacting Southern Railway’s Assisted Travel team in advance is recommended. With step-free access facilitated by ramps and a level crossing, it remains relatively accessible, albeit certain areas could be challenging for those with mobility issues.
